File consists of program and recordings for performance held on Mar. 25, 2015, Tanna Schulich Hall, Schulich School of Music, McGill University, Montreal. Featuring: Canadian Music for Voice and Instruments ; Robert Aitken, flute (1st and 7th works) ; Katherine Watson, flute (1st, 10th, and 11th works) ; Tom Plaunt, piano (2nd, 6th, 9th, and 11th works) ; Elizabeth Dolin, cello (3rd work) ; Charles-Richard Hamelin, piano (3rd work) ; Ilya Poletaev, piano (4th and 5th works) ; Jessica Wise, soprano (6th, 8th, and 11th works) ; Orpheus Singers (7th work) ; Andrea Stewart, cello (8th work) ; Scott Ross-Molyneux, harp (8th work) ; Kristan Toczko, harp (10th work) ; Peter Schubert, conductor ; Brian Cherney, coordinator. Works: Aitken, Robert, 1939- My Song: shadows IV.; Commentary [spoken words]; Mathieu, Rodolphe, 1890-1962. Trois préludes.; Dolin, Samuel. Variables.; Commentary [spoken words]; Southam, Ann, 1937-2010. Bagatelles, piano ; Pentland, Barbara, 1912-2000. Fantasy.; Commentary [spoken words]; Mercure, Pierre, 1927-1966 ; Charpentier, Gabriel. Dissidence.; Aitken, Robert, 1939- ; Aitken, Karen. Monodie.; Mather, Bruce. A child in Kiev.; Somers, Harry, 1925-1999. Two solitudes.; Beecroft, Norma. Pezzi brevi.; Charpentier, Gabriel. Tea symphony or the perils of Clara.
